EU - Ostrich sales go off, the first ostrich slaughterhouse was set up

Published: November 25, 2004
Source : Hoovers Online
Studanka (Zidovice, Czech Republic), ostrich processing firm, has commissioned the first ostrich slaughterhouse in Zidovice in the region Litomerice, the Czech Republic. The slaughterhouse kills about 50 ostrichs per week. The firm should supply about 3,000 ostrich meat pieces to the market in 2005. The price of ostrich steak is CEK 320 per kg. The firm exports the majority of production to Austria, Germany, Italy and Belgium. The company purchases ostrichs from Czech, Slovak and Polish breeders. It offers CEK 50 per one kg of live weight. The firm also processes ostrich feathers and ostrich leather for handbag and shoe production. It breeds 150 own ostrichs in Zidovice. The number should increase four-times in 2005.
